Transaction e6260001970c4264b2fa87f24f5379b831cdfd7ad8abada8fdd6b1955dc6b27f

11 Input
2 Outputs
  • e6260001970c4264b2fa87f24f5379b831cdfd7ad8abada8fdd6b1955dc6b27f:0
  • value  100000000
    address  3JxBB9s3me9jRhW6MGYxswv6bfQW9Bup1k
  • e6260001970c4264b2fa87f24f5379b831cdfd7ad8abada8fdd6b1955dc6b27f:1
  • value  4816663
    address  bc1qu3vqycyl54u3fcvy960vhfr2y2l2ahxmrc5dz6